Alliant Insurance Services has named Adrienne Johnson (pictured above) as a vice president within its employee benefits group.

Based in Nashville, Johnson will focus on providing strategy-driven employee benefits solutions to clients in the Southeast and across the country. 

Johnson brings 20 years of experience in the employee benefits sector, having held positions as an analyst, consultant, and group leader. Her background includes expertise in healthcare cost management, population health strategies, and compliance.

She has worked with clients across multiple industries to develop benefits programs that align with financial and operational goals. 

Before joining Alliant, Johnson served as health and benefits managing director at an international insurance and consulting firm. She holds a master’s degree in business administration from the University of Florida and is a board member of the Nashville YWCA. 

Alliant Employee Benefits president Kevin Overbey said Johnson’s experience will help clients navigate compliance risks and financial sustainability in their benefits programs.

“Adrienne is a proven strategist who works alongside her clients to deliver solutions that are financially sustainable and minimize compliance risk,” Overbey said. “Her ability to bring service, innovation, and collaboration to the table will provide a distinct advantage to our clients and their employees.”

Last week, the national brokerage further expanded the division with the appointment of Crystal Calvo, also as a vice president with the employee benefits group.

Based in San Diego, Calvo will lead a team focused on professional employer organization (PEO) solutions, working with clients nationwide to enhance payroll, benefits administration, and risk management. 

Calvo brings experience in benefit strategy, payroll technology, and compliance. In addition to client-facing responsibilities, she will focus on producer education and retention initiatives.

She previously served as senior broker relationship manager in the PEO division of a major payroll technology firm. Calvo holds a bachelor’s degree in global studies and political science from the University of California, Santa Barbara.
